A Bi-lingual chatbot implementation for pandemic response using the transformer-based approach
Mugume Twinamatsiko Atwine1, Daudi Jjingo1,2,3, Mike Nsubuga1,2,4,5
1African Centers of Excellence in Bioinformatics and Data-Intensive Sciences, Kampala, Uganda.
A new bilingual chatbot provides 24/7 access to accurate COVID-19 pandemic information in English and Luganda. This AI tool combats misinformation and improves public health communication during global health crises.

Background:
- The COVID-19 pandemic underscored the need for reliable information dissemination.
- Misinformation on public platforms complicated pandemic management, requiring significant human resources.
- A scalable solution was needed to provide trustworthy, real-time health information.
Purpose of the Study:
- To develop an intelligent, bilingual chatbot for pandemic information.
- To provide 24/7 access to medically curated information in English and Luganda.
- To leverage AI to combat health misinformation and improve public health communication.
Main Methods:
- Developed a deep learning-based chatbot trained on a corpus of pandemic information.
- Utilized Natural Language Processing (NLP) frameworks for bilingual capabilities.
- Implemented a conversation-driven development approach for continuous improvement.
Main Results:
- Successfully implemented a chatbot providing accurate pandemic information in English and Luganda.
- Demonstrated the chatbot's ability to leverage English NLP for Luganda language interaction.
- Showcased the chatbot as an effective tool for real-time information dissemination.
Conclusions:
- The developed chatbot is an effective and flexible tool for managing pandemic information.
- AI-powered chatbots can significantly enhance public health communication during crises.
- Continuous improvement through user interaction ensures the chatbot's ongoing relevance and accuracy.
